Honoring the Memory of Brad Etheridge: A Skilled Brewer and Cherished Member of the Community

In the news from Atwater Brewery, Brad Etheridge was recognized as a standout brewer with a strong presence in the Grosse Pointe community. His sudden and tragic passing in a car accident has left many hearts heavy with grief. Despite his life being tragically cut short, Brad’s legacy of passion, creativity, and community involvement lives on. Coming from the California music scene, he made a lasting impact on the Michigan craft beer industry, leaving behind a legacy filled with unforgettable memories, meaningful relationships, and noteworthy achievements.
